Q: Is 85,847,029 a Prime Number?
A: No, 85,847,029 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 85847029 can be evenly divided by 1 31 2,769,259 and 85,847,029, with no remainder.
Since 85,847,029 cannot be divided by just 1 and 85,847,029, it is not a prime number.
